Located in the southern hemisphere, South Africa's summer stretches from September to April and winter is from May to August. The Kruger National Park, however, is hot and dry all the year round - summer or winter. The average temperature ranges from 18°C to 30°C. The summer months are sunny and see occasional showers; temperatures in the shadow range from 18°C to 30°C. The winter months, meanwhile, are warm and dry, with temperatures between 8°C and 22°C. December, January and February are the hottest months of the year, when temperatures in Western Kruger go over 31°C and rarely fall below 20°C. During this season, tourists are likely to spot the animals at the waterholes in the mornings and evenings.
While this hot region does experience some amount of summer rainfall, the rainy season never guarantees as much rain as the locals would like. Thus, droughts are sometimes experienced. During winter, the days are usually bright and clear and the evenings are cold.
